🤖 AI Summary
A recent article emphasizes the ongoing evolution in software engineering as large language models (LLMs) automate routine coding tasks, shifting engineers' roles toward code auditing and review. However, it warns against the misconception that engineers should simply transition into project management roles. The core argument is that true engineering involves deep problem-solving and hands-on experience, not merely ticket management or AI prompting.
The significance for the AI/ML community lies in recognizing that while LLMs excel at generating boilerplate code, they cannot replace the nuanced, experiential knowledge that engineers bring to complex problem-solving. Real engineering challenges, such as diagnosing memory leaks or navigating unpredictable system behavior, require a level of intuition that can only be developed through direct engagement with intricate architectures. The article stresses that companies that downplay the value of deep technical expertise risk creating fragile systems. Therefore, engineers are encouraged to focus on critical problem areas rather than conform to corporate fantasies that diminish their role.
Loading comments...
login to comment
loading comments...
no comments yet